Chris Thile

Deceiver

2004-10-26

23-year-old mandolin master Chris Thile (Thee-lee) has lead bluegrass phenoms Nickel Creek to international popularity. Yet, his vision consistently leads him beyond the bounds of his band.

Thile now delivers his 4th solo album and the first featuring vocals. Chris acts as the sole musician on the new disc, playing over 25 instruments - from his signature mandolin to percussion, strings and keys.
